    Reducing Draw Calls

    Reducing draw calls is a vital strategy for optimizing rendering performance in graphics applications. Each draw call represents a request to the graphics API to render a specific object. Excessive draw calls can lead to performance bottlenecks, particularly in complex scenes. Fewer draw calls improve efficiency.

    To minimize draw calls, developers can employ techniques such as batching and instancing. Batching combines multiple objects into a single draw call, reducing overhead. This method is effective for static objects that share similar properties. Instancing allows for rendering multiple copies of an object with a single draw call. This is particularly useful for repeated elements, such as trees in a landscape.

    Additionally, using texture atlases can further reduce draw calls. A texture atlas consolidates multiple textures into one, allowing for fewer state changes during rendering. This approach streamlines the rendering process.

    Efficient Use of Textures

    Efficient use of textures is essential for optimizing rendering performance in graphics applications. Textures enhance visual quality but can also consume significant memory and processing resources. Therefore, managing textures effectively is crucial for maintaining high performance. He must consider both quality and efficiency.

    One effective strategy is to utilize texture atlases. By combining multiple textures into a single image, he can reduce the number of texture bindings required during rendering. This minimizes state changes and improves overall performance. Fewer state changes lead to smoother graphics.

    Another important aspect is mipmapping, which involves creating lower-resolution versions of textures. This technique allows the graphics engine to select the appropriate texture resolution based on the distance from the camera. It reduces the workload on the GPU while maintaining visual fidelity. This is particularly beneficial in large scenes.

    Additionally, compressing textures can significantly save memory without sacrificing quality. Various compression formats are available, each with its trade-offs.     Implementing Level of Detail (LOD)

    Implementing Level of Detail (LOD) is a crucial technique for optimizing rendering performance in graphics applications. LOD allows developers to use different models for an object based on its distance from the camera. This approach reduces the complexity of rendering distant objects, which are less visible. It enhances overall performance.

    Typically, LOD involves creating multiple versions of a model, each with varying levels of detail. For example, a high-detail model may be used when the object is close, while a simpler version is displayed when it is farther away. This strategy minimizes the computational load on the graphics processing unit (GPU). Lower load means better performance.

    Seventh chords add complexity and richness. They can enhance emotional depth in a piece. Additionally, there are extended chords, which include ninths and elevenths. These chords provide a more sophisticated sound. Understanding these types is essential for effective composition.

    How Chords are Formed

    Chords are formed by combining specific notes played together. He explains that each chord consists of a root note and additional intervals. Major chords include the root, major third, and perfect fifth. Minor chords replace the major third with a minor third.

    Seventh chords add another note, creating tension. This tension enhances musical expression. Understanding intervals is crucial for chord formation. It allows musicians to create diverse sounds. Each combination yields a unique emotional response.
